Kathmandu Valley sees 123 fresh COVID-19 cases


28 January 2021

KATHMANDU: As many as 123 persons have been infected with COVID-19 in the Kathmandu Valley in the last 24 hours.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, 107 cases have been confirmed in Kathmandu, 6 in Bhaktapur, and 10 in Lalitpur.

Meanwhile, Nepal recorded a total of 213 new cases of coronavirus infection in the past 24 hours.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, the coronavirus tally reached 2,70,588 in the country as of Thursday afternoon.

Likewise, the Ministry shared that now the country has 3,203 reported active cases of the virus.

In the past 24 hours, altogether 296 infected people got recovery from the virus infection.

So far, 2,65,365 people recovered from the coronavirus infection in the country.

Similarly, no additional COVID-19 deaths across the country in the past 24 hours, keeping the country’s death toll to 2,020.
